Job Duties

  • Deliver food orders from the kitchen to customers' tables rapidly and accurately
  • Act as the point of contact between Front of the House and Back of the House staff
  • Communicate food orders to chefs, paying attention to priorities and special requests (e.g., food allergies)
  • Assist the wait staff with table setting by fetching and placing appropriate tableware, eating utensils, and napkins
  • Serve welcome drinks and hors d'oeuvres upon guests' arrival
  • Ensure food is served in accordance with safety standards (e.g., proper temperature)
  • Check in with customers and take additional orders or refill water, as needed
  • Remove dirty dishes and utensils
  • Answer guests' questions about ingredients and menu items
  • Inform restaurant staff about customers' feedback or requests (e.g., when they ask for the check)
